The Perfect King

Book • 2006
Ian Mortimer's 'The Perfect King' provides a detailed and engaging account of Edward III's life, from his ascension to the throne as a minor to his transformation of England into a thriving nation.

The book delves into Edward's military prowess, his impact on English culture, and the complexities of his character.

Mortimer challenges traditional views of Edward as a warmonger, presenting a nuanced portrait of a king who was both brilliant and brutal.
